Thorpe Market
Thorpe Market, a pleasant North Norfolk village, which has a number of pretty cottages surrounding the green
This delightful corner of rural Norfolk is only five miles from the traditional seaside town of Cromer, famous for its delicious crabs and the end of the pier shows. Also within easy reach are the Norfolk Broads, the fascinating network of waterways where day boats are available for hire.
The area is ideal for cycling with many designated "quiet lanes". Close by is a cycle track along a disused railway line that gives a unique opportunity to explore unspoilt Norfolk with its abundance of wildlife. The more ambitious cyclist may like to attempt the full route into Norwich.
Easily accessible too, are the picturesque villages of the North Norfolk coast, much loved by sailors and offering a number of RSPB reserves, lovely coastal footpath walks and seal-watching trips. Good fishing and a choice of golf courses can be found within 5 miles.
Buses There is a bus stop in the village just 500m walk away with direct services to Cromer and North Walsham, with connections to Norwich and Great Yarmouth
Trains - Gunton station is 1 mile with connections to Norwich & London, and to Cromer and Sheringham, where connections can be made to the North Norfolk Railway that runs steam trains into Holt
